Janet Kennedy is a scholar working on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, Cell Biology and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Janet Kennedy has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 558 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, 4 papers in Cell Biology and 3 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Janet Kennedy’s work include Aldose Reductase and Taurine (4 papers),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(4 papers) and Biochemical effects in animals (2 papers). Janet Kennedy is often cited by papers focused on Aldose Reductase and Taurine (4 papers),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(4 papers) and Biochemical effects in animals (2 papers). Janet Kennedy coll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and Italy. Janet Kennedy's co-authors include Thomas L. Perry, Shirley Hansen, Nadine Urquhart, Scott C. Chappel, C. L. Dolman, Søren B. Hansen, Joe B. Harford, Charles J. Waechter, Gertrude Thompson and Jun Wada and has published in prestigious journals such as Analytical Biochemistry, Endocrinology and Journal of Neurochemistry.
